David Luiz has made almost 200 appearances for Chelsea over two stints at Stamford Bridge but the Brazilian had to endure a frustrating campaign during the concluded season.
The 31-year-old lost his place in the Chelsea team after Chelsea were thrashed 3-0 by Roma in the Champions League as Antonio Conte opted for Andreas Christensen in his stead afterwards.
Luiz then struggled with persistent injury problems after Christmas and featured in just five matches for Chelsea in 2018.
Reports claim the Brazilian who is a fan favourite at Stamford Bridge, could be used in a swap deal to bring Elseid Hysaj to Chelsea.
Reports now claim that Luiz has also emerged as a surprise target for London rivals Arsenal.
According to Le10 Sport, the Gunners submitted an official offer for the Brazilian but saw their £17.6m approach rejected.
